When is the best time to visit Trout Creek for a holiday rental?
The peak travel season in Trout Creek runs from June to August, with July being the most popular month for visitors. This vibrant time of year attracts outdoor enthusiasts eager to immerse themselves in the area's stunning natural beauty, with opportunities for hiking, fishing, and river rafting under the warm Montana sun.

During these summer months, you can expect pleasant temperatures, typically ranging from the mid-teens to mid-twenties Celsius, superb for enjoying outdoor activities and sightseeing. The lush landscapes and clear skies make it an ideal backdrop for relaxation and adventure alike.

For those seeking more affordable options, consider a visit in October. While this month may see fewer tourists, it offers a unique charm as the fall foliage transforms the scenery into a vibrant tapestry of colours. Crisp air and serene surroundings create an inclusive setting for leisurely walks and reflective moments in nature.

Ultimately, the best time to visit Trout Creek hinges on your preferences—whether you're drawn to the bustling energy of summer adventures or the tranquil beauty of autumn's embrace.

What are the top attractions in Trout Creek?
In Trout Creek, Montana, visitors can enjoy a range of attractions that highlight the area's natural beauty and outdoor activities. The nearby Clark Fork River is ideal for fishing, kayaking, and river rafting, making it a popular spot for water enthusiasts. The surrounding Cabinet Mountains provide excellent hiking opportunities, with trails offering stunning vistas and chances to see local wildlife.

For those interested in winter sports, the nearby ski areas, such as Lookout Pass, are accessible for skiing and snowboarding during the winter months. The area is also known for its serene landscapes, with opportunities for photography, bird watching, and camping, making it a superb destination for nature lovers.
